Don Edward Wright makes his home in Redwood City, California, with his wife Michelle and their son Chris. Born and raised in the Midwest, he learned the American work ethic at a very young age.
Attending Ohio State University, in Columbus, he received a degree in Mass Media/Marketing.
|
Don enlisted in the United States Marine Corps and served as an officer, stationed with the 807 Tactical Fighter Wing of the 7th Fleet at Cam Rahn Bay, Vietnam.
In 1973 the radio and television industry became the honing ground where he developed his sales and marketing skills in such major marketing as K.C.M.O Radio, Kansas City, and W.L.S., Chicago in 1979, he, and his family moved to Northern, California where he opened his first office. His initial consulting contracts included such firms as AT&T, Westec Industries and Crysler Corporation. In 1990 The Phoenix Group Marketing Corporation was founded.
Today The Phoenix Group employs over 60 people, all in specialized positions designed to give clients the best possible marketing value for their dollars.
Don Edward Wright has gone on to receive his M.B.A. from the University of California at Los Angeles, and his 32 degree in Masonry. Currently he is involved in negotiating new sales and marketing ventures with both the Japanese and Mexican Governments.
